MySQL是一款開源的關系型數據庫管理系統,可以用于創建表格、存儲數據以及對數據進行操作。在MySQL中,臨時表是一種特殊的表格,它的生命周期只在當前的會話中存在,當會話結束時,臨時表將自動被刪除。
然而,需要注意的是,MySQL并不支持在臨時表的創建中使用一些特殊的條件,例如無法在臨時表中使用存儲過程、觸發器、外鍵等。此外,在創建臨時表時,也無法使用SELECT INTO語句來初始化表格,需要通過INSERT語句將數據插入到表格中。
CREATE TEMPORARY TABLE IF NOT EXISTS temp_table ( id INT NOT NULL AUTO_INCREMENT PRIMARY KEY, name VARCHAR(20) NOT NULL ); INSERT INTO temp_table (name) VALUES ('MySQL'), ('臨時表'), ('使用限制');
需要注意的是,臨時表在MySQL中并不是一項必需功能,在一些場景下,可以使用其他的替代方案來實現相應的功能。對于MySQL的臨時表使用限制,建議開發人員在實際應用中,根據具體的情況進行評估和取舍。
上一篇html幻影圖片代碼
下一篇python 播放音符